      Hi Ken, I’ve noticed something strange yesterday and today. This has happened a few times.

      If I leave the site and then come back sometime later, the page I was viewing when I left is displayed instead of the main page. Also, the left menu is displaying with the old red balls, instead of the new “button style” links.

      If I click links, they stay the red ball style even as I navigate to new pages. If I refresh, the red balls go away and the button style menu comes back.

      I am using a Mac running OS 9.0.1, IE 5.1.4. A few weeks ago I changed my cookie settings (but I didn’t notice this bug until yesterday) — I now have the browser prompt me before accepting a cookie. I accept cookies for this site, though. (See the picture below.) And, I cleared out all cookies before changing this setting a few weeks ago… so I’d be surprised if this red ball style menu was sitting around on my computer somewhere.

      I wasn’t able to empty my cache (kept getting a message that I couldn’t delete items in use, even after I shut down IE), but I figured out a little bit more about the problem. In my favorites, I have this URL bookmarked:

      http://www.sierragamers.com/MainFrame.asp 

      When I start up IE and go to the favorite, I’m automatically redirected to http://www.sierragamers.com/newMainFrame.asp 

      However, if I navigate away from the site and then back to it (using the favorite), I’m taken to MainFrame.asp and am not redirected. Once I shut down IE and start it again, the favorite redirects me to newMainFrame.asp

      Clearly, I could fix this by updating my favorite (grin), but maybe it’s indicative of other problems with pages not refreshing/redirecting correctly? I have had this URL in my favorites for months, and only started having this problem this week.
